Yeah, but "berghain techno" is becoming super prevalent these days, as not only do the residents play everywhere, but a lot of big name Berlin DJs jumped onto that sound a few years ago. It seems like every few years Berlin/German techno gets stuck in a stylistic rut for a bit, it was that way in the early 2000s with "big room" tresor style sounds. I feel it was really Ostgut/Berghain (with Shed, Marcell Dettmann and Ben Klock) who got it going somewhere interesting again, but for the last bit it seems that what was big in 2008/9 is still what's big, and we need another push forward.
